      • Light Requirement: Full Sun, Part Sun
      • Mature Height: 18 – 24 IN
      • Lifecycle: Perennial
      • Botanical Name: Nepeta cataria
      • Family: Lamiaceae

      How to Sow and Plant

      How to Sow and Plant

      • Sowing Directly in the Garden:
        • Sow outdoors in spring after the last frost. In frost-free areas, sow from fall to early spring.
        • Choose well-drained soil in full sun or part sun.
        • Sow seeds thinly and cover lightly with soil.
        • Keep the soil moist until seeds germinate.
        • Seedlings emerge in 7-14 days.
      • Sowing Seed Indoors:
        • Sow seeds indoors 6-8 weeks before the last frost.
        • Plant seeds ¼ inch deep in seed-starting mix.
        • Keep the soil moist at 70°F.
        • Seedlings emerge in 7-14 days.
        • Once seedlings are large enough, transplant them outdoors after the danger of frost has passed.

      FAQs

      FAQs

      • Why does catnip attract cats?
        • Catnip contains a compound called nepetalactone, which affects the sensory neurons of cats, causing behaviors like rolling, rubbing, and purring.
      • How do I use catnip in my garden?
        • Plant catnip in well-drained soil and full sun. It can be used as a decorative herb, and its scent can help deter certain pests.
      • Can catnip be used in cooking or herbal remedies?
        • Yes, catnip can be used to make herbal teas and has been traditionally used to relieve stress and digestive issues.
